Years should be expressed as numerals except at the beginning of a sentence. Most style guides agree that beginning a sentence with a numeral is poor style, so years placed at the beginning of a sentence should be written out as words.American writers tend not to use and after thousandwhen expressing a year … See more When referring to a specific date in the month-day date format, use cardinal numbers (one, two, three) rather than ordinal numbers (first, second, third). This may feel counterintuitive because we normally use ordinal … See more This is the way to think about writing decades using numbers: they are both abbreviations and plurals. A shorter way of saying “My mother was born in the 1940s” is “My mother was … See more For example, when we write the 1800s, we are referring to all the years from 1800 to 1899. Within that range are one hundred discrete years; that is, more than one: a plural. All dates have to be exactly two numbers, so the first nine days of each month have a zero in front of the actual number. This ensures there is no duplication in numbers and no variation in the number of characters. 1st = 01. 2nd = 02.
